SANY C. BUSMEON (1ST PRIZE WINNER) is 47 years old, Married and with 3 children.
Living in Liluan Santander, Cebu City.
The payment of the 1st winner of the 2014 tag lottery was presented to Sany
Busmeon and Tag Recovery Officers Glennville Castrence and Medel Ian Lipio at the port
fronting the Bureau of Fisheries and Aquatic Resources office. The reward was amounting to
Php47, 180.70 or USD1,078.4.

QUESTIONER SHEET FOR LOTTERY WINNERS
Before the presentation of the Lottery prize the winners were interviewed:
1. Now that you are the 1th winner of 2014 lottery, how are going to spend your money?
I will use the money as a capital to start a small business for my children.
2. What company you are now working?
I am still working with Trans Pacific Journey onboard Martina Elizabeth.
3. For how many years you have been working with this company?
I have been working with TPJ for 26 years.
4. What do you do onboard?
I work as a master fisherman on board purse seiners.
5. Since you’ve started how many tags did you find?
I always find tags on every vessel I board. Its roughly 60 tags I found since I
started
6. When you find the tags, what do you with the tags?
I kept on board until the vessel returns to port and I exchange the tag with
TROs for additional cash allowance and sometimes exchange the tags with
other vessel crew for goods and cigarettes.
7. When you find tags, how do you get the fishery information to fill the tag recovery form?
I normally obtain the fishery information from the vessel log sheet and fill the
tag recovery forms or ask assistance with the observer onboard and keep it for
reward purposes.
8. Do the fisheries observers on board assist you, when you find the tags?
Yes
9. What do say about this tag lottery? Your point of view.
I am thankful that I am one of the winners specially that I got the 1st prize. I
hope there will be more lotteries to come and more tags to be found.
